The chargeable weight of an individual parcel is the gross or dimensional weight rounded up to the nearest kilo. The chargeable weight of a multi-parcel consignment is the aggregate total of each individual package rounded up to the nearest full kilo.
Dimensional weight will be applied on Domestic & International Economy Express deliveries where the volume of any single parcel exceeds 4,000 cubic centimeters per kilo. For Global Express, the conversion factor is 5,000 cubic centimeters per kilo and for Sea Freight, the conversion factor is 6,000 cubic centimeters per kilo.
How to Measure Your Parcel Size
It is recommended that you calculate the dimensional weight for every parcel that you send then compare this to its actual weight. The greater weight of the two is used to calculate the price that we charge you.
